Output 2603bb68ca1153f2a7ac217759c203c285542db01c3f6a58f3d42d29da3c984b:0

value
4446321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b96accecd5622184b0931e4ec40edf8fecc3fdda OP_EQUAL
address
3JbQsfFxUU4hRBoG6g9esdXWNxb12YjuW6
transaction
2603bb68ca1153f2a7ac217759c203c285542db01c3f6a58f3d42d29da3c984b
spent
true